Cross-ratio based gaze estimation using display light reflections on cornea detected by polarization camera system

Abstract

Cross-ratio method can estimate point-of-gaze on a screen without performing a hardware calibration, and it has a tolerance of the head movement. However, this method requires the display, which near-infrared light-emitting-diodes are attached on, to detect screen corners. Therefore, we developed a polarization camera system to detect screen reflection on cornea without near-infrared-light emission. Most of the liquid crystal display has an internal polarizing filter, and thus, the transmitted light can be controlled by the external polarizing filter. We performed the evaluation experiment of cross-ratio based gaze estimation using display corner detection from polarized images.
